7. What is 40% of 160?  Be sure to show your work! Write your Ratio Equation on your White Board.

x/160 = 40/100       P/W = %/100


X= 64

64 is 40% of 160

9.Your family went to a restaurant where the total came out to $112.  Since you enjoyed the meal, your family decides to leave a 22% tip.  How much will your family pay?  Be sure to show your work! 

1. Set up your equation:

p/w = %/100       X/160= 22/100

2. Decide to Either Add or subtract the Part from the Whole Amount.  P= $24.64   W= $112

Add your tip money: $24.64 + $112 = $136.64

8. A pair of shoes costs $65.50, but you have a coupon that takes off 15%.  How much will the shoes cost after using the coupon?  Be sure to show your work!

P/W = %/100

x/$65.50 = 15/100

x= $9.825    then decide to Add or subtract from Whole amount $65.50.  

$65.50 - $ 9.825 = $55.675 or $55.68 pay for shoes
